来源:小编 更新:2024-11-17 01:42:35
用手机看
随着农业模拟游戏的兴起,模拟农场19(Farm Simulator 19)成为了许多玩家喜爱的游戏之一。对于想要自己动手开发类似游戏的玩家来说,以下是一篇简易开发指南,帮助您开始您的农场模拟游戏之旅。
游戏引擎:选择一个合适的游戏引擎是开发游戏的第一步。Unity和Unreal Engine是两款流行的游戏引擎,适合初学者和专业人士。
编程语言:熟悉至少一种编程语言,如C(Unity)或C++(Unreal Engine),这对于游戏逻辑和交互至关重要。
3D建模和动画:了解3D建模和动画制作的基本原理,这对于创建游戏中的农场设备和环境至关重要。
在众多游戏引擎中,Unity和Unreal Engine是最受欢迎的。以下是选择游戏引擎时需要考虑的因素:
Unity:
易于上手,适合初学者。
拥有庞大的社区和资源库。
支持2D和3D游戏开发。
Unreal Engine:
提供高质量的视觉效果。
适合制作大型、复杂的游戏。
拥有强大的物理引擎。
游戏目标:玩家在游戏中要实现的目标是什么?例如,种植作物、养殖动物、经营农场等。
游戏玩法:游戏的核心玩法是什么?例如,模拟真实农场操作、经营策略等。
游戏环境:游戏中的环境设置,如农场、村庄、市场等。
设计一个有趣且具有挑战性的游戏概念,将吸引更多玩家。
3D建模:使用3D建模软件(如Blender、Maya)创建游戏中的物体和角色。
纹理制作:为3D模型添加纹理,使其看起来更加真实。
动画制作:为角色和物体添加动画,使其具有动态效果。
音效制作:为游戏添加背景音乐和音效,增强游戏氛围。
您可以选择自己制作游戏资产,也可以从第三方资源库购买或下载。
脚本编写:使用所选游戏引擎的脚本语言编写游戏逻辑。
事件处理:处理游戏中的各种事件,如玩家操作、时间变化等。
物理引擎:利用游戏引擎的物理引擎实现物体间的交互。
确保游戏逻辑清晰、稳定,为玩家提供良好的游戏体验。
功能测试:确保游戏中的所有功能都能正常工作。
性能测试:优化游戏性能,确保游戏运行流畅。
用户测试:邀请玩家测试游戏,收集反馈意见。
不断测试和优化,提高游戏质量。
完成游戏开发后,发布和推广是吸引玩家的关键。以下是一